Few weeks ago I discovered that Amazon gives an unlimited space on its Amazon Photos service for all Amazon Prime members. If you like photography and keep a backup of all your pics on this Amazon Drive follow these few lines where I'm gonna show what you need to do. The automation described is configured for a Synology NAS, but this could be easily triggered also on a QNAP or a Backup Server (easier with Linux but also on Windows can be done).

The interesting part is that there are no limitation for all photos formats: jpg, tiff,png, and even all image formats and all RAW formats (Canon, Nikon, Sony etc..). Personally I store more NEFs (Nikon's NEF) than JPEGs, so this sounded really good to me.
